Transaction 602434864198a2839d3682cfdc8a60be46ce23edc480f6fce07a849b961c967e
1 Input
1 Output
-
602434864198a2839d3682cfdc8a60be46ce23edc480f6fce07a849b961c967e:0
- value
- 39040494
- script pubkey
- OP_0 OP_PUSHBYTES_20 66c991e2a946e2555ce176aa3f12c2974ff64065
- address
- ltc1qvmyerc4fgm392h8pw64r7ykzja8lvsr9388lrg